Values in table are in micron and [W m**-2 micron**-1] Multiply by a target's geometric albedo spectrum, and divide by r (AU; solar range to target) and PI, to get the target's specific intensity. Refer to [HOWETTETAL2016] for detail. This generic spectrum has not been resampled at the LEISA spectral resolution, but it is not used in the calibration of LEISA data, It has been provided to resolve a lien issued during a peer review of LEISA data sets.
